diff --git a/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config/.config/glib-2.0/settings/keyfile b/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config/.config/glib-2.0/settings/keyfile new file mode 100644 index 0000000..557c629 --- /dev/null +++ b/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config/.config/glib-2.0/settings/keyfile @@ -0,0 +1,29 @@ +[org/cinnamon/desktop/interface] +icon-theme='Mint-Y-Dark-Orange' +gtk-theme='Mint-Y-Dark-Orange' + +[org/cinnamon/desktop/wm/preferences] +theme='Mint-Y' + +[org/cinnamon/theme] +name='Mint-Y-Dark-Orange' + +[org/cinnamon] +next-applet-id=16 +enabled-applets=['panel1:left:0:menu@cinnamon.org:0', 'panel1:left:1:show-desktop@cinnamon.org:1', 'panel1:left:2:grouped-window-list@cinnamon.org:2', 'panel1:right:2:systray@cinnamon.org:3', 'panel1:right:3:xapp-status@cinnamon.org:4', 'panel1:right:4:notifications@cinnamon.org:5', 'panel1:right:5:printers@cinnamon.org:6', 'panel1:right:6:removable-drives@cinnamon.org:7', 'panel1:right:8:favorites@cinnamon.org:9', 'panel1:right:9:network@cinnamon.org:10', 'panel1:right:10:sound@cinnamon.org:11', 'panel1:right:11:power@cinnamon.org:12', 'panel1:right:12:calendar@cinnamon.org:13', 'panel1:right:0:keyboard@cinnamon.org:15'] + +[org/gnome/libgnomekbd/keyboard] +layouts=['de', 'us'] + +[org/nemo/preferences] +default-folder-viewer='list-view' +inherit-folder-viewer=true + +[org/gnome/gedit/preferences/editor] +scheme='classic-light' + +[org/cinnamon/desktop/background] +picture-uri='file:///usr/share/backgrounds/linuxmint-una/nwatson_eclipse.jpg' +picture-options='zoom' + + diff --git a/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config_1.0.bb b/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config_1.0.bb new file mode 100644 index 0000000..c676f9b --- /dev/null +++ b/recipes-cinnamon/cinnamon-default-config/cinnamon-default-config_1.0.bb @@ -0,0 +1,15 @@ +SUMMARY = "Cinnamon default user configuration" +LICENSE = "MIT" +LIC_FILES_CHKSUM = "file://${COREBASE}/meta/COPYING.MIT;md5=3da9cfbcb788c80a0384361b4de20420" + +inherit allarch + +SRC_URI = " \ + file://.config \ +" + +do_install() { + # default user configration -> /etc/skel + install -d ${D}${sysconfdir}/skel + cp -r ${WORKDIR}/.config ${D}${sysconfdir}/skel/ +} diff --git a/recipes-support/packagegroups/packagegroup-cinnamon-base.bb b/recipes-support/packagegroups/packagegroup-cinnamon-base.bb index 46a9f37..cb5a761 100644 --- a/recipes-support/packagegroups/packagegroup-cinnamon-base.bb +++ b/recipes-support/packagegroups/packagegroup-cinnamon-base.bb @@ -14,6 +14,7 @@ RDEPENDS:${PN} = " \ mint-y-icons \ cinnamon \ cinnamon-control-center \ + cinnamon-default-config \ cinnamon-desktop \ cinnamon-menus \ cinnamon-screensaver \